On a queer and neverending quest through the fantasy films of the 80s & 90s, and all the memories and feelings they conjure up. From animated adventures and sword and sorcery epics to magical romcoms and fairytale horror, we will journey through the big blockbusters and cult classics.

Frequently Asked Questions About Once Upon A VHS

What is Once Upon A VHS about and what kind of topics does it cover?

Exploring the fantasy films of the 80s and 90s, the episodes evoke nostalgia while unpacking memories associated with these cinematic classics. The discussions range from animated adventures and sword-and-sorcery epics to magical romantic comedies and fairy tale horrors, reflecting on both blockbusters and cult favorites. The hosts often incorporate their personal connections to these films, discussing themes of identity, nostalgia, and queer representation, which adds a vibrant and inclusive spirit to the overall journey through this beloved era of film. Listeners can expect a thought-provoking yet humorous exploration that resonates deeply with those who grew up during this time.
